As a courtesy title the Honorable describes an individual: This person is honorable. As such it never precedes just the name of an office. Honorable or Hon. are not used in direct address -- on a letter or place card, or in a salutation or conversation -- as honorifics like Mr., Mrs.
”All sons of a viscount have the courtesy title of 'The Honorable' before their forename and surname. The style of 'The Honorable' (usually abbreviated to 'The Hon') is only used on the envelope in correspondence, in written descriptions (usually only on the first mention) or in formal documents.
Address the letter to your Representative as The Honorable (full name). The salutation is Dear Mr. (Surname): Congressman is not formally used as an honorific.
In addition to the standard Commonwealth usage, the Speaker of the House of Representatives was entitled to be referred to as The Honorable until 2010, when it was announced that sitting and future Governors-General, Prime Ministers, Chief Justices, and Speakers of the House of Representatives would be entitled to be
The honorific is reserved for the President, the Vice President, United States senators and congressmen, Cabinet members, all federal judges, ministers plenipotentiary, ambassadors, and governors, who get to use the title for life. State senators and mayors are The Honorable only when in office.
His/Her Majesty: HM. His/Her Royal Highness: HRH. His/Her Grace: HG. The Most Noble: TN. The Most Honorable: The Most Hon (The Most Hobble) The Right Honorable: The Rt Hon (The Rt Hobble) The Honorable: The Hon (The Hobble) The Much Honored: The Much Hon (The Much Hon'd)
The straightforward rule for writing to any of the above is that if you are writing to an unnamed 'Sir' or 'Madam', you use 'Yours faithfully'. If you are addressing a specific person, whether by name or by title/position, you use 'Yours sincerely'.
The prefix 'The Hon Mr/Mrs/Ms Justice' is dropped on retirement and retired judges are then styled, for example, as 'The Hon Sir Jonathan Dean' or 'The Hon Lady Jacklin'. A person appointed to sit (part-time) as a deputy High Court judge is addressed in court as for a High Court judge.
